Opera Festival Teplice

The Teplice Opera Festival is a young innovative European initiative: ten cooperation partners from six different European States have come together to realize the idea of a new opera festival.

In the historical theatre of the city of Teplice, performances of precious and glittering music theatrical gems from the inexhaustible European opera repertoire will be held, in some cases for the first time since their premieres in previous centuries. Many of these works were neglected for their supposed irrelevance during the subsequent political events of past eras. Today, with Europe reawakening and reinventing its significance, these important works of music theatre represent a treasure trove of theories, utopias and fertile intra-European cross connections. Apart from Teplice, performances will also be held in other European locations that clearly reflect Europe's destiny.

Plans include the scenic and semi-staged presentation of a series of performances of both serious and light-hearted subjects between the eighteenth and twentieth centuries. In the context of a master class, the festival aims to introduce vocal students from all over Europe to the international opera stage, alongside renowned singing personalities. The artistic forum will be complemented by an international conference devoted to scientific, political and historical issues in relation to the world of the arts.
